Connected devices can remove small daily frictions, but convenience has a maintenance cost. Every app, account and cloud dependency adds another point that may change long before the appliance itself wears out.

The best smart-home purchase still works when the Wi-Fi does not.

Begin with the ordinary

Look first for sound insulation, efficient motors, accessible filters and controls anyone can understand. Connectivity should extend those strengths, not stand in for them.

Plan the exit

Before buying, ask what happens if the manufacturer ends support. Local controls, replaceable parts and common standards preserve more of a product’s value—and make a connected home feel calmer.
